OEM and private-label development is a coordinated business process. The starting point is a clear market requirement and product brief, followed by confirmation of the product, branding, packaging, documentation and order conditions. Availability, minimum quantities, lead times and testing requirements must be confirmed for the specific project rather than assumed.
Define the country or region, customer type, use case and intended sales channel.
Provide the required product type, dimensions, grades, format, packaging quantity and any reference sample.
Prepare approved logos, colors, languages, label content, barcode data and packaging format.
Identify the technical, regulatory, shipping and market documentation required for the destination.
TMILES reviews the requested product, market, quantity, packaging and documentation requirements.
Both parties confirm the product configuration and the points that still require samples or testing.
Where applicable, samples, labels and packaging artwork are reviewed before production approval.
Confirm quotation, minimum quantity, lead time, payment terms, packaging and shipping information for the specific order.
Proceed only from the approved specification and retain the agreed product and packaging references.
